San Antonio, Texas; (1984 and 1989): Association of Old Crows. First Editions. Quarto. In two volumes. 312 and 391pp. volume I covers "The Years of Innovation", covering the story of US electronic warfare from its beginnings until 1945. It includes much unpublished material.. Volume II "The Renaissance Years" continues the story from 1946 to 1964. Here the issues of the Cold War traces the various techniques of radar jamming, intelligence, and has penetrated areas after the declassification of many World War II documents. The rapid evolution of radio and radar systems for military use during World War II, and devices to counter them, led to a technological battle that neither the Axis nor the Allied powers could afford to lose. The result was a continual series of thrusts, parries and counter-thrusts, as first one side then the other sought to wrest the initiative in the struggle to control the other.
